2,3-Dichloroaniline

98%

  • Product Code: 71813
  CAS:    608-27-5
  Properties:    dark brown solid
Molecular Weight: 162.02 g./mol Molecular Formula: C₆H₅Cl₂N
EC Number: 210-157-9 MDL Number: MFCD00007657
Melting Point: 20-25 °C Boiling Point: 252 °C
Density: 1.37 g/cm3 Storage Condition: room temperature
Product Description: Primarily used in the synthesis of dyes and pigments, 2,3-Dichloroaniline serves as a key intermediate in producing colorants for textiles, plastics, and inks. Its role in the creation of agrochemicals is also significant, as it is utilized in the development of herbicides and pesticides, contributing to crop protection and agricultural productivity. Additionally, this compound finds application in pharmaceutical research, where it is employed in the synthesis of various active pharmaceutical ingredients (APIs) and intermediates. Its chemical properties make it valuable in organic synthesis, particularly in the production of complex organic compounds used in industrial and research settings.
